Airplane Design Part VII: Determination of Stability, Control and Performance Characteristics is the seventh book in a series of eight volumes on airplane design. The airplane design series has been internationally acclaimed as a practical reference that covers the methodology and decision making involved in the process of designing airplanes. Educators and industry practitioners across the globe rely on this compilation as both a textbook and a key reference.
Airplane Design Part VII: Determination of Stability, Control and Performance Characteristics familiarizes the reader with the following fundamentals:
- Controllability, maneuverability and trim
- Static and dynamic stability
- Ride and comfort characteristics
- Performance prediction methods
- Civil and military airworthiness regulations for airplane performance and stability and control
- The airworthiness code and the relationship between failure states, levels of performance and levels of flying qualities
